What is an Accident Injury Claim Attorney?
An accident injury claim attorney is a legal expert concentrated on representing people who have actually sustained injuries in accidents. Their main goal is to assist clients acquire compensation for damages, consisting of medical expenses, lost salaries, pain and suffering, and more. The complexities of injury law require the knowledge of these lawyers to make sure that victims receive reasonable treatment and compensation from insurer or at-fault celebrations.

The Process of Filing an Accident Injury Claim
The process of filing a claim can be complex and differs depending on the situations. Below is a simplified overview of the phases included:
StageDescriptionAssessmentThe customer meets the attorney to discuss the accident, injuries, and possible damages.InvestigationThe attorney gathers evidence, including medical records, authorities reports, and witness statements.Submitting a ClaimAn official claim is filed with the insurance provider or suitable legal entity.SettlementThe attorney negotiates with the insurance company to reach a fair settlement.LawsuitsIf settlements stop working, the attorney gets ready for trial and represents the customer in court if required.Settlement or VerdictThe case concludes with either a settlement agreement or a decision from a judge or jury.Kinds Of Cases Handled by Accident Injury Claim Attorneys

Just how much does it cost to work with an accident injury claim attorney?
Most accident injury claim lawyers work on a contingency cost basis, meaning they only get paid if you win your case. Their charges typically range from 25% to 40% of the settlement amount.
2. For how long do I have to submit a claim?
The statute of constraints differs by state but typically ranges from one to three years after the accident. It's vital to speak with an attorney as soon as possible to prevent missing out on the due date.
